Ola.. eu estou usando o QrCompositeReport para gerar relatorios...funciona perfeito desta forma: procedure TFormCxTrafegoSint.QRCompositeReport1AddReports(Sender: TObject); begin QRCompositeReport1.Reports.Add(QuickRep1);  // contas a receber QRCompositeReport1.Reports.Add(QuickRep2);  // contas a pagar end; No botão de Imprimir ... FormCxTrafegoSint.QrDataIni.Caption:=DateToStr(DateTimePicker1.Date); FormCxTrafegoSint.QrDataFin.Caption:=DateToStr(DateTimePicker2.Date); FormCxTrafegoSint.Q